Five Things You Need to Know Today: March 1
Member appreciation week at the YMCA, info on an internship and yes, more playoff news.

1. Member appreciation week. Today is the last day of the West Suburban YMCA's Member Appreciation Week -- members can check out fun activities, events and giveaways.
2. Farm internships. The Newton Community Farm is looking for high school interns for the summer.
3. Latest Playoff news. The Newton North boys' basketball team defeated Madison Park last night, 52-24, and will go on to face Taunton on Saturday at Newton North at 4 p.m. Unfortunately, the Newton South boys' lost a first round game to Mansfield last night, 72-56, to end their season. As for tonight's games, the Newton South girls' basketball team will face Durfee in a quarterfinal match at Durfee (Fall River) at 7 p.m.

4. Interested in becoming a Newton Police officer? The deadline to apply or a 2013 police officer examination (administered by the state) is March 18. Applications are available at Newton City Hall, any city/town clerk's office or online. Check out the Mass HRD website for more information.
5. Cultural festivals kick off tomorrow. The Newton Heritage Festivals kick off tomorrow with a French celebration at the Newton Cultural Center. The event runs from 10 a.m. - 5 p.m. and will include music, food, activities and more.
